The Tottori Nijisseiki Pear Museum is situated in the city of Kurayoshi, within the Tottori Prefecture of Japan. This location is easily accessible and offers a unique cultural experience for visitors interested in the history and cultivation of pears.
The Tottori Nijisseiki Pear Museum is dedicated to the history of the pear. Visitors can learn about the cultivation process, the significance of pears in the region, and the evolution of pear farming over the years.
